@charset "UTF-8";
/* CSS Document */ 

@font-face {
    font-family: 'GnuolaneFree';
    src: url('fonts/gnuolane_free-webfont.eot');
    src: local('☺'), url('fonts/gnuolane_free-webfont.woff') format('woff'), url('fonts/gnuolane_free-webfont.ttf') format('truetype'), url('fonts/gnuolane_free-webfont.svg#GnuolaneFree') format('svg');
    font-weight: normal;
    font-style: normal;
}


body{
    background: url('../imagenes/fondo/fondoRestaurante.jpg') ;
    background-attachment: fixed;
    background-position: center center;
    margin:0;
    padding:0;

}
.bodyfondo{
    background: url("/imagenes/fondo/fondoBraille.png") repeat scroll 0 0 transparent;
    width: 100%;
    height: 100%;
    position: fixed;
    z-index: -1;
}
h1{
    font-family:Calibri,sans-serif;
    font-size:11px;
    font-weight:bold;}

h2{
    font-family:Calibri,sans-serif;
    font-size:11px;
    font-weight:bold;}

a, a:visited{
    text-decoration:none;
    color:#333;
}

.flechita{
    height:11px;
    width:11px;
    font-weight:bold;
    float:left;
    font-size:9px;
}

.titulillos{
    font-size:12px;
    font-family:Calibri,sans-serif;
    font-weight:bolder;
    margin-top:5px;
    margin-bottom:3px;
}


#toTop {
    background-image: url(../imagenes/flecha.jpg);
    background-position: left top;
    background-repeat: no-repeat;
    bottom: 200px;
    display: none;
    float: left;
    height: 55px;
    position: fixed;
    right: 0px;
    margin-right:0px;
    width: 55px;
    z-index: 5000;
    cursor: pointer;
    color: #000;
}


.social{
    height:45px;
    width:45px;
    background-color:#333;
}

#tip{
    position:absolute;
    left:0;
    right:0;
    border: solid 1px #ccc;
    background:#FFF;
    padding:8px;
    display:none;
    text-align: center;
    font-family:Arial, Helvetica, sans-serif;
    font-size:11px;
    color:#666;
    text-align:center;
    z-index:5001;
}


#container{
    background-repeat: repeat-x;
    float: left;
    height: 430px;
    width: 100%;
    overflow: hidden;
}


#cabecera{
    width:100%;
    height:128px;

    margin:0 auto;
    float:left;
    top:0;
    z-index:10001;
}
#logoAlpuntodesal{
    width:940px;
    height:128px;
    margin:0 auto;
    top:0;
}



#divSegundo{
    background-color: #FFFFFF;
    height: 443px;
    margin: 4px auto auto auto;
    width: 940px;
}

.listado{
    width:940px;
    height:92px;
    margin:auto auto;
    float:left;
}
.tituloListado{
    height:33px;
    margin: auto auto;
    width:160px;
    background-image:url(../imagenes/fondoIntroTitulo.png);
    background-repeat:repeat-x;
    font-family: 'GnuolaneFree', Verdana, Arial, san-serif;
    font-size:16px;
    text-align:center;
    color:#FFF;
    padding-top:8px;
}
.preguntaIntro{
    height:15px;
    margin: auto auto;
    width:400px;
    font-family: Verdana, Arial, san-serif;
    font-size:12px;
    text-align:center;
    color:#000;
}

.respuestaIntro{
    height:25px;
    margin: 3px auto auto auto;
    width:550px;
    font-family: Verdana, Arial, san-serif;
    font-size:12px;
    text-align:center;
    color:#000;
}

.respuestaCheck{
    height:20px;
    width:100%;
    font-family: Verdana, Arial, san-serif;
    font-size:12px;
    text-align:center;
    color:#000;
    float:left;
}

.respuestaCombo{
}

.cajaDegustar{
    width:940px;
    height:74px;
    margin:auto auto;
    float:left;
}
.botonDegustar{
    height:74px;
    margin: auto auto;
    width:160px;
    font-family: 'GnuolaneFree', Arial, san-serif;
    font-size:11px;
    text-align:center;
    color:#FFF;
}

#pie{
    width:100%;
    height:135px;
    float:left;
    text-align:center;
}

#pieCentral{
    background-color:#fff;
    width:940px;
    height:95px;
    margin:auto auto;
    border-top:solid 3px #000;
}

#pieMiniLogo{
    height:25px;
    width:940px;
    float:left;
    font-family:Verdana, Arial ,sans-serif;
    font-size:11px;
    color:#fff;
    margin:10px auto 0px auto;
}

#pieItem{
    height:7px;
    width:940px;
    float:left;
    font-family:Verdana, Arial ,sans-serif;
    font-size:11px;
    color:#000;
    margin:5px auto 5px auto;
    border-bottom:solid 1px #000;
    text-align:center;
    padding-bottom:5px;
}

#pieCajaDerecha{
    height:42px;
    width:940px;
    float:left;
    font-family:Verdana, Arial ,sans-serif;
    font-size:11px;
    color:#000;
    margin-top:10px;
}

#pieCajaIzquierda{
    height:46px;
    width:163px;
    float:left;
    font-family:Verdana, Arial ,sans-serif;
    font-size:11px;
    color:#000;
}
#pieDirecciones{
    height:15px;
    width:940px;
    float:left;
    font-family:Verdana, Arial ,sans-serif;
    font-size:11px;
    color:#000;
    margin:0px auto;
}

#pieCopyright{
    height:17px;
    width:940px;
    float:left;
    font-family:Verdana, Arial ,sans-serif;
    font-size:11px;
    color:#000;
    margin:20px auto;
    text-align:center;
    margin:auto auto;
}

.botonimagen {
    background-image: url("/imagenes/botonDegustarFade.png");
    border: 0 none;
    height: 61px;
    width: 160px;
    cursor: pointer;
}

.botonimagen:hover{
    background-image:url(/imagenes/botonDegustar.png);
}
#header {
    margin: 0 auto;
    padding: 0;
    text-indent: -9999px;
    width: 940px;
    height: 128px;
    position: relative;
    background: url(/imagenes/cabeceraIntro.jpg) no-repeat;
}
#header a {
    position: absolute;
    top: 0;
    left: 0;
    width: 940px;
    height: 128px;
    display: block;
    border: 0;
    background: transparent;
    overflow: hidden;
    cursor: default;
}

#header .fake-hover {
    margin: 0;
    padding: 0;
    width: 940px;
    height: 130px;
    display: block;
    position: absolute;
    top: 0;
    left: 0;
    background: url(/imagenes/cabeceraIntro.jpg) no-repeat 0 -128px;
}